Nike Stock: Is the Worst Over?
Investors hoping for a turnaround at Nike (NYSE: NKE) will have to wait longer.
The world's leading sportswear company posted yet another quarter of declining revenue and profits and told investors that things would get worse in the fiscal fourth quarter, the current period.
The quarter marked Nike's fourth straight period of declining revenue as sales fell 9% to $11.3 billion, dragging earnings per share down to $0.54, well below the $0.98 it reported after adjustments in the quarter a year ago.
